About Couples Therapists in Waynesboro, PA

Finding the right couples therapist in a smaller community like Waynesboro, Pennsylvania, can feel both more personal and more challenging. With only one couples therapist currently listed in the Waynesboro area, it is important to approach your search with a clear sense of what you and your partner need. Couples therapy is most effective when both partners feel heard and respected, so consider whether you prefer a therapist who uses a structured approach like the Gottman Method or Emotionally Focused Therapy, or one who offers a more flexible, conversational style. Since Waynesboro is a close-knit town near the Maryland border, you may also want to ask about the therapist’s experience with local dynamics, such as the stress of commuting for work or balancing rural and suburban lifestyles.

Before committing to a session, ask the therapist key questions about their experience with couples, their typical session structure, and how they handle conflict or communication breakdowns. It is also wise to inquire about their availability, fees, and whether they offer virtual sessions, which can expand your options beyond Waynesboro if needed. A good local therapist understands the unique pressures of the area, such as the seasonal workforce changes tied to agriculture or manufacturing in Franklin County, and can tailor their guidance to your specific situation. Finding someone who is both professionally skilled and attuned to your community can make a significant difference in building trust and making progress.

Ultimately, investing time in finding a therapist who is a strong fit for both of you is crucial, especially when local choices are limited. A strong therapeutic alliance often leads to better outcomes in couples counseling, so do not hesitate to schedule an initial consultation to gauge comfort and rapport. Whether you choose the one therapist in Waynesboro or expand your search to nearby cities like Hagerstown or Chambersburg, prioritizing a good match over convenience will help you and your partner build healthier communication and deeper connection. Remember that seeking help is a sign of strength, and the right therapist can provide the tools to navigate even the most challenging relationship seasons.

Does insurance cover couples therapy?

Coverage varies by plan and provider. Some insurance plans cover couples counseling. Contact your insurance company and the provider's office to confirm.
